There are 3 types of hair wig hair meant for making a wig. The 3 types are: synthetic, human and heat friendly synthetic. The 3 types all have their own features and can do different things. It is not necessary to choose one over the other because they are all unique in their own way. However, the features may help you to choose the hair that you would like to use. Here is a list of the features and some guidelines to remember when choosing the hair that you will use:

Synthetic Hair

Synthetic Hair

1) Made to look like human hair, but is made of plastic fiber that is often cheaper than human hair.

2) The colors in the synthetic hair are not easily going to fade. They are made using a process that is similar to textile dying and color fade is slim to none.

3) There are multiple color and texture options, which include: curls, waves, straight, etc.

4) The style that is set on a wig made f synthetic hair will not lose its style on a hot/humid day.

5) Will last 1-6 months with possibility of more depending on if you properly care for your wig.

6) Do not do any styling on a wig made of synthetic hair.

7) Do not heat or blow dry a wig made with synthetic hair.

8) To care for a wig made of synthetic hair, use a synthetic shampoo and conditioner to make sure that it is properly washed. Doing so may make your wig last longer.

9) Will not dye from it's natural color.

Heat Friendly Synthetic Hair

1) You can use up to 350 Degrees F on heat friendly synthetic hair.

2) This hair will last 1-6 months.

3) Use a heat friendly synthetic shampoo and conditioner to wash this hair.

4) when curling, always make sure that hair is completely dry before removing the curlers

Human Hair

1) Human hair is said to look more realistic than synthetic.

2) Human hair can be colored and handle heat (irons, blow dryers, etc)

3) You must reset and restyle a wig that is made of human hair after washing it.

4) A human hair wig will last 1-36 months.
